Output 351f7063a518ef1709c866c985090168bf4ca2d4707be4c1a2bdfe4c0a050cb8:859

value
142815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ea1ec1aa7403ba827c96cb94c45d045208b8905 OP_EQUAL
address
MF4vux5AAvfoAA4ups7rwMExAWQ834k6dg
transaction
351f7063a518ef1709c866c985090168bf4ca2d4707be4c1a2bdfe4c0a050cb8
spent
true